- 締切済み
エクセルで横置きのシートにページ数をつける
エクセルで、縦置き横置きが混在する書類を作りました。ファイルにとじた状態ですべて右下にページ数がつくように印刷したいんですが、フッターの設定等にてよい方法がありますか?
- みんなの回答 (6)
- 専門家の回答
みんなの回答
- enunokokoro
- ベストアンサー率74% (3543/4732)
フッターのようにセルに関係なく自動でページを入れてくれるVBAの作り方は、VBA勉強中の私にはわかりません。難しそうですよね。 ただ、エクセルは半角数字を90度回転できませんが、全角ならできます。 シートのなかにページを書き入れたいセルを用意して、行列を調節して1ページに収まるようにします。 縦置きの書類はそのまま全角の数字を記入します。セルの書式設定 を開き 配置→文字の配置のそれぞれのリストから選択。 横書きの書類は、 セルの書式設定→配置タブ→方向→縦書きの文字列 を選択 フォントタブ→フォント名の表示しているフォントの頭に@をつけて 上記のように文字の配置を調節 あとは、全書類のページの位置が同じになるように細かく設定 60枚ぐらいなら、ガンバッテ作ってみてください。
- enunokokoro
- ベストアンサー率74% (3543/4732)
夜中に気になって起きてしまいました。 >左下に時計回りに90度回転したフッター ありえません エクセル2002だと強引な方法であるのですが。 図をフッターに入れます。 つまり、縦置きは右側に説明したページの替わりに図を入れます。 横置きは、左下に時計回りに90度回転してつくった図を入れます。 図はペイントなどでページ分作り、横置き用に左下に時計回りに90度回転した図を作り1つずつ入れていく これはフッターに強引に入れる方法なので手で書いたほうが良いのでは。(図をアイコンぐらいの大きさでカッコよく作れば見た目は良いかも)
- enunokokoro
- ベストアンサー率74% (3543/4732)
No.2です。 フッターの設定は各シート毎にしなければならないのですが、シートをすべて選択した状態で設定してみてください。 一回ですべて設定できます。 ただしページ設定がすべて同じになるようなので、向きやその他の設定をよく確認してください。
補足
用紙サイズはすべてA4で片面印刷です。主に縦置きですが、たまに(全体約60ページのうち5~7ページ)横置きが発生します。当然別シートに作成しているファイルなのでその都度手動で開始ページ数を指定するつもりです。ようするに用紙を横置きにした場合、左下に時計回りに90度回転したフッターページ数を印刷させる方法があれば感激です。
- enunokokoro
- ベストアンサー率74% (3543/4732)
No.2です 補足 >右下にページ数 でしたね。 フーッターのリストから「1ページ」を選びフッターの編集ボタンを押し、&[ページ番号]ページと書かれているのが「中央部」になっているので、「右側」に書き写して中央部を消せばOK。
- enunokokoro
- ベストアンサー率74% (3543/4732)
>ファイルにとじた状態ですべて右下にページ数がつくように印刷 ではないのですが シート毎にそれぞれ書類があるとして メニューのファイル→ ページ設定→ ヘッダー/フッター タブのフーッターのリストから好みのものを選ぶ。 書類のあるシートをすべて選択→ 印刷プレビューで確認 たぶん、シート毎にページ設定の印刷の向きが正しければページはシート順に入っていると思いますが。 ページの表記を数字だけにしたい場合は、フーッターのリストから「1ページ」を選びフッターの編集ボタンを押し、&[ページ番号] ページの後ろのページを消せばOK。
- umarewa3gatu
- ベストアンサー率14% (7/50)
僕は結局分からず、テキストボックスを使って横書き資料にも対応しましたが、かなり強引でした。 ページをうって→テキストボックスを90°回転→印刷プレビューをみて、位置合わせ。 枚数が多くて大変でしたが(・・;)
お礼
最後の手段としてそれも考えました。枚数が多いのと微妙に位置が変わるので、手書きも含めて検討します。
補足
無理なんでしょうか VBE使ってもいいので教えてください。